Princess Anne's son, Peter Phillips, made a rare appearance at Wimbledon with his new girlfriend, Harriet Sperling.
Peter, whom Princess Anne shares with her ex-husband Mark Phillips, attended the event in a navy blazer, khaki pants, white shirt, and a navy-and-red striped tie. Harriet, whom the royal has been dating for the past year, wore a light blue linen skirt set. Peter and Harriet met their public debut in May 2021 at the Badminton Horse Trials, where Peter's sister, Zara Tindall, was competing.

Peter's public appearance with his girlfriend comes after his divorce from his ex-wife, Autumn Phillips, whom he separated from in 2020 before finalizing their divorce in 2021.
'Mr Peter Phillips and Mrs Autumn Phillips are pleased to be able to report that the financial aspects of their divorce have been resolved through agreement, the terms of which have been approved and ordered by the High Court today,' a spokesperson for Peter said in a statement at the time. Whilst this is a sad day for Peter and Autumn, they continue to put the wellbeing and upbringing of their wonderful daughters Savannah and Isla first and foremost. Both Peter and Autumn are pleased to have resolved matters amicably with the children firmly at the forefront of those thoughts and decisions. Peter & Autumn have requested privacy and consideration for their children as the family adapts to a new chapter in their lives.'
Peter's public appearance also comes after The New York Post reported that Peter's cousin, Prince William, who is first in line for the crown after King Charles, is keeping his cousins on 'ice' ahead of his inevitable ascension to the throne. While the report specifically mentioned Peter and William's cousins, Princess Eugenie and Princess Beatrice—who are the daughters of Prince Andrew and Sarah Ferguson—it's possible that William's plan could extend to other family members. 'They're valuable assets and I'm certain they'll get involved with royal duties when William becomes king,' Ingrid Seward, royal author and editor-in-chief of Majesty Magazine, told Hello! magazine.
Seward added that she was 'certain' Beatrice and Eugenie will 'get involved with royal duties' once William becomes king. (Currently, the sisters are not working members of the Firm.) 'It makes perfect sense, because he will need them,' Seward said. 'I see them as a sort of double act, working together in the same way as married couples do. Two gorgeous Princesses working together as sisters would be very powerful. I think it would be wonderful, and I think it will happen.'
Buckingham Palace sources also told the New York Post that Beatrice and Eugenie are 'well aware' of William's plans for them. 'I think they would be open to doing more, because they like to give back,' Seward told Hello!, adding that the sisters are 'being kept on ice' until their new roles come.
She added, 'They have always been close to William, and the King is very fond of them too. I see them taking on the sort of role that Princess Alexandra and the Duchess of Kent had when they were younger, working very hard doing philanthropic work, but not taking center stage.'
Seward also predicted that Beatrice and Eugenie will become 'much higher profile' once William becomes king.
'I think people see them as a couple of really charming young married women who are relatable and aren't entitled,' she said. 'And I think people feel for them because they've got this family problem, with their father, which is very embarrassing and difficult for them.'

It's looking more likely that Prince George is heading to Eton—despite Prince William and Kate Middleton feeling "plagued by indecision" about sending their eldest son there. According to the Daily Mail, Prince George has been "allocated a house" at the prestigious school amid staffing changes. "Eton has been going through much transition lately so that's perhaps why it wasn't an easy decision," an insider tells the outlet. "There has been a lot going on that isn't public knowledge but which Catherine would, of course, have been informed of. "She has been wise to wait and observe for a few more months for things to settle down, which it has thanks to Nicholas Coleridge's hand on the tiller and Simon Henderson's return–though that has its own dilemmas because he's not everyone's ideal Eton headmaster." Eton has 25 so-called houses of them and the most prestigious is King's Scholars—while both Prince Harry and Prince William attended the storied circa 18th century Manor House. There was previously some speculation that Wills and Kate would send George to Marlborough College instead of Eton, but that seems unlikely since another source recently told the Daily Mail that "all roads lead to Eton" and the school has been "smug" about it. As an insider put it, "It was like, 'I know something and the people at Eton know something, but I'm not going to tell you'. That was after William and Kate visited Eton." The Princess of Wales showed her feelings as the couple were walking into the BAFTA Film Awards at the Royal Festival Hall, in London, on February 19, 2023. The couple were walking past a fan who was filming on a cell phone when she gave William a cheeky pat on the backside, behavior that might cause more conservative royal watchers to raise an eyebrow. A clip of the moment resurfaced on TikTok where it was liked 27,000 times and viewed 280,000 times having been posted with the message: "Kate 👀🍑." Why It Matters Royals have not always been known for public displays of affection. In 1953, when Queen Elizabeth II returned from a six-month tour of the Commonwealth without her children she famously shook Charles' hand rather than hug him. In the modern world, though, the family are far more public with their feelings, including PDAs like Kate's at the BAFTAs. What to Know As the prince and princess made their way down the red carpet at the Royal Festival Hall, cameras captured Kate giving William a subtle pat on the behind—a rare public display of affection that got fans talking on social media at the time. Kate stunned onlookers, in a reworked Alexander McQueen gown and opera gloves, while William opted for a velvet tuxedo. The affectionate gesture was subtle—easily missed if not for a slow-motion clip circulating online—but it quickly became one of the night's most talked-about moments. Royal watchers applauded the glimpse of lightheartedness between the couple, interpreting it as a sign of their enduring bond.
